Summary: | This research paper examines the dynamic behavior of a heterogeneous two-server queuing model that incorporates differentiated vacation periods. Additionally, the model accounts for the possibility of a disaster occurring during busy periods and vacations, with immediate initiation of the repair process. The motivation for this study stems from the two types of power-saving mechanisms found in IEEE 802.16E. The paper presents explicit expressions, obtained using generating functions, for the time-dependent probabilities of system size, expressed in terms of modified Bessel functions. To further validate the theoretical findings, numerical illustrations have been included. |
